Detroit Lions: Harrison, Slay report to training camp on time

This has to be a bit of a relief for the organization as well as fans of the Detroit Lions.

Damon “Snacks” Harrison and Darius Slay both reported to training camp in Allen Park, MI on time. Both players are currently seeking new contracts with the team.

If you’re a Lions fan, you understand how important both of these players are to Matt Patricia’s defense. Harrison’s run-stopping ability helped the Lions’ defense turn a corner last season after he was acquired before the trade deadline.

Darius Slay has been a premiere cornerback in the NFL for years now and is needed in the secondary.
